Man jailed for 4 weeks for attacking RTHK reporter during Occupy protests

A 56-year-old man named So Si-kit has been sentenced to four weeks in jail for injuring Mak Ka-wai, a video journalist for RTHK.

So pleaded guilty earlier this month, reports RTHK.

The attack occurred during last year’s pro-democracy protests in Mong Kok.

Mak sustained injuries to his face in the incident.

Last year, Coconuts Multimedia Director Alexander Hotz was punched while filming in Mong Kok.
